简介
为Blazor项目添加Dockerfile
三个小改动
1)默认Dockerfile中需要拷贝NuGet.Config
2)不要忽略.pfx证书
3)不能忽略wwwroot/libs文件夹
4)提示找不到/libs/bootstrap/css/bootstrap.css
[00:35:21 ERR] Connection id "0HN28EMETUCCN", Request id "0HN28EMETUCCN:00000002": An unhandled exception was thrown by the application.
Volo.Abp.AbpException: Could not find file '/libs/bootstrap/css/bootstrap.css'
第一次运行abp install-libs
提示需要安装yarn(实际上签入到Gitlab后,依然提示找不到bootstrap.css)
按照向导安装yarn
再次运行abp install-libs
有了bootstrap.css:
签入代码后自动构建成功
后记
这篇文章4个小改动,折腾了7次构建。值得记录下来。
标签:Ami,bootstrap,id,BlazorOne,添加,libs,Docker,签入,css From: https://www.cnblogs.com/amisoft/p/18084344